The GNOME developers released yet another bugfix version of the Folks (libfolks) package for the GNOME desktop environment, a library that aggregates your contacts from multiple sources.

Folks 0.9.6 now depends on GLib 2.38.2 or later and Vala 0.22.0.28-9090 or later. This version adds a BlueZ backend and uses Vala to generate GIR files, which fixes a number of bugs.

Moreover, Folks 0.9.6 addresses several important issues (sixteen to be more exact), and introduces various build system and testing improvements. More details about the Folks 0.9.6 release can be found in the official raw changelog.
